The only tip I could think of is that puzzle games like this have the tendency to get people stuck in very unpredictable places.
Games like "baba is you" have a solution for that by making it possible to skip a level.
I shouldn't bother for a game-jam game. But if you want to make it a full-on game then it's something to think about.
